Not sure why your guests avoid these-My sister has a stomach problem and needs to keep a very struct spiceless diet.
she makes a fab soup using only orange fleshed vegetable like sweet potato,carrot and pumpkin and a sprinkle of ground dried thyme
if you just slightly roast the vegtables before you add the water and make sure your cook them long enough- the soup gets a very rich,slightly sweet taste.
You can also add a little coconut milk to it
If you're addicted to pepper-lentils have "peppery" flavours and can be made into mash or soup
